Chris Eubank Jr. and Conor Benn announce a grudge battle to renew their father's rivalry

Chris Eubank Jr and Conor Benn have announced that they will resume their family feud on October 8 at The O2 Arena in London.

Benn's father Nigel is a super middleweight champion when he fought Eubank's father Chris Sr. in the 1990s when he jumped two weight classes for a super fight. The pair will meet at a catchweight of 156 pounds for the first time in nearly 29 years since his father last fought them to a draw at Old Trafford in Manchester.

Eubank Jr. is still eyeing a match with the winner of Gennady Golovkin vs. Canelo Alvarez, or a rematch with Billy Joe Saunders, but he'll take a slight detour for this nostalgic superfight. Ben has climbed the ranks at welterweight and is likely to return to the campaign in the future if he makes a fortune in this historic bout.
